## Ownership

Hey support folks — this is FareForge, our rules engine that calculates shipping fees for everything moving through the Quillhaven storefront. Zones, weight brackets, promo overrides: it all lives here. If a customer swears they were quoted one fee and charged another, 90% of the time it's a stale rule cache, so check that first. For anything weirder — conflicting rules, negative fees, the works — don't guess. Rule changes need approval anyway, so route everything through the engine's owner, listed right below.

named custodian: Belius Casath Ulaix Sorius

Subject: Tile cache notes for your first shift

Hi Wren,

As you begin on-call for the Mapfen tile-rendering cache, please note that plugin-generated tiles use a separate eviction tier with shorter TTLs. If plugin authors report stale tiles, verify the tier assignment before purging. The cache architecture and purge procedure are fully documented here.

runbook for tafof-yawif: https://confluence.tolvaqsys.internal/display/display/browse/pages/7be3

Release checklist — Meridia Planner 4.2

Verify the calendar sync conflict fix before sign-off. Create two overlapping events in Glintbox Calendar and sync against the Meridia staging tenant; the older event should win and the newer one should land in the Conflicts tray, not silently overwrite. If you see duplicate entries, stop and flag the release owner. Once both directions sync cleanly three times in a row, mark this item done and record the build token below.

trace token, kahog-tajeg: htk6_97d963

Vendor note: Branchreaper, the stale-branch cleanup bot we license from Tidelock Systems, runs nightly against all repos in the Harkwell org. It deletes branches with no commits in 90 days, excluding anything matching the protected-pattern list in the Tidelock console. If it deletes something it shouldn't, restores are possible within 30 days via their dashboard. Our contract includes 24/7 support with a two-hour response SLA. For urgent restore requests or pattern-list changes, reach the Tidelock vendor desk directly.

escalation mailbox, bafog-fafog: ulador@paliqlabs.internal